Reliable long snapper<br />

was a last-minute injury<br />

replacement for J.J.<br />

Jansen following the 2008 preseason and went on to perform<br />

the job almost flawlessly for all 16 games…Signed<br />

by Green Bay as a free agent on Sept. 1, 2008, three days<br />

after Jansen suffered a season-ending knee injury in the<br />

PRO<br />

career<br />

preseason finale vs. Tennessee…Without<br />

a team for 2008 training camp, was pouring<br />

concrete for a driveway in 93-degree<br />

heat in home state of Arkansas when the<br />

Packers called…Earned his first <strong>NFL</strong> roster spot after two<br />

failed attempts with Jacksonville, having originally signed<br />

as an non-drafted rookie free agent with the Jaguars in<br />

April 2007, and participated in training camp prior to being<br />

waived on Aug. 20 of that year...Re-signed with Jacksonville<br />

on March 5, 2008, and attended the team’s offseason<br />

program, before being released on June 16, 2008...<br />

Attended college at the University of Arkansas, where he<br />

was a four-year letterwinner at long snapper for the Razorbacks...Appeared<br />

in 49 games during his collegiate career,<br />

collecting seven special teams tackles along the way...<br />

Served as the point man for the team’s punting operation<br />

in each of his four seasons, and snapped for all of the kicking<br />

placements during his final three years.<br />

2008 season<br />

Handled snapping duties in all 16<br />

games, and recorded two tackles<br />

and a fumble recovery on special teams…At Tennessee<br />

(Nov. 2): Registered first career special teams tackle<br />

when he brought down Chris Carr at the Tennessee 28 on<br />

Derrick Frost’s 55-yard punt early in the fourth quarter…<br />

Vs. Houston (Dec. 7): Recovered first career fumble<br />

when he jumped on Jacoby Jones’ muffed catch at the<br />

Green Bay 49 on fourth-quarter punt, setting up offense<br />

for touchdown drive that tied the game at 21…At Chicago<br />

(Dec. 22): Snapped the ball to QB Matt Flynn on<br />

fake punt in second quarter on 4th-and-2 that Flynn took 6<br />

yards for the first down.<br />

college<br />

A four-year letterwinner at the University<br />

of Arkansas, appeared in 49 games while<br />

snapping for all punts each of his four seasons and for all<br />

kick placements his final three years…Tallied seven special<br />

teams tackles in his career, at least one in each of his<br />

four seasons…Majored in kinesiology with an emphasis<br />

in teaching.<br />

personal<br />

Given name Brett Goode…Last name<br />

is pronounced GEWD…Born in Pampa,<br />

Texas…Single…High school: Attended Northside High<br />

School in Fort Smith, Ark., lettering as both a long snapper<br />

and a center on the offensive line...Also lettered in<br />

baseball…Community involvement: Participated in<br />

an event to benefit the Green Bay Traffic Club…Hobbies/<br />

interests: Enjoys playing golf, fishing, cooking and playing<br />

guitar…Residence: Split between Fort Smith, Ark., and<br />

Green Bay.<br />
